Marco Schuster has been the standout performer for Hansa Rostock in league play this season with a rating of 7.51. Florian Carstens and Kenan Fatkic have also impressed with ratings of 7.42 and 7.36 respectively.

Emil Holten leads Hansa Rostock's scoring in league play with 10 goals this season. Ryan Don Naderi has contributed 8, while Kenan Fatkic has added 6.

Cedric Harenbrock is the chief creator for Hansa Rostock in league play with 4 assists this season. Marco Schuster and Ryan Don Naderi have also been key playmakers with 4 and 4 assists respectively.

Hansa Rostock have been in excellent form recently, winning 4 of their last 5 matches (80% win rate). They have scored 12 goals and conceded 4 during this period. Overall, they have shown good attacking threat. Defensively, they have been solid, conceding an average of 0.8 goals per game. In the 3. Liga, their recent results include a 3-2 win against RW Essen, a 3-1 win against TSV Havelse, a 0-0 draw with Energie Cottbus, a 5-1 win against MSV Duisburg, and a 1-0 win against Wehen Wiesbaden.

Looking ahead, Hansa Rostock have 3 home games and 2 away fixtures in their next 5 matches. Upcoming opponents: Viktoria Köln 1904 (home), SC Verl (away), Ulm (home), FC Schweinfurt (away), and Jahn Regensburg (home).

Hansa Rostock currently sits in 6th place in the 3. Liga with 53 points from 30 matches (14W 11D 5L).

Hansa Rostock's squad consists of 27 players. Goalkeepers: Benjamin Uphoff (Germany), Philipp Klewin (Germany), Max Hagemoser (Germany). Defenders: Ahmet Gürleyen (Germany), Lukas Wallner (Austria), Florian Carstens (Germany), Jan Mejdr (Czechia), Leon Reichardt (Germany), Franz Pfanne (Germany), Viktor Bergh (Sweden). Midfielders: Kenan Fatkic (Slovenia), Marco Schuster (Germany), Jonas Dirkner (Germany), Nico Neidhart (Germany), Cedric Harenbrock (Germany), Paul Stock (Germany), Lukas Kunze (Germany), Adrien Lebeau (France), Christian Kinsombi (Germany), Felix Ruschke (Germany), Milosz Brzozowski (Poland), Benno Dietze (Germany). Forwards: Andreas Voglsammer (Germany), Emil Holten (Denmark), David Hummel (Germany), Maximilian Krauß (Germany), Fiete Bock (Germany).

Hansa Rostock transfers: New signings include Lukas Kunze (from Arminia Bielefeld), Emil Holten (from Elfsborg), Viktor Bergh (from Djurgården), Lukas Wallner (from Hannover 96), Andreas Voglsammer (from Hannover 96) and 1 more. Players transferred out include Ryan Don Naderi (to Rangers), Louis Köster (to Holstein Kiel).

Daniel Brinkmann is the current head coach of Hansa Rostock. Under their leadership, the team has achieved a 52% win rate across 56 matches, averaging 1.79 points per game.

Notable previous managers include Bernd Hollerbach managed the club for one season, recording 2 wins from 11 matches (18% win rate). Alois Schwartz managed the club for 2 seasons, recording 10 wins from 25 matches (40% win rate). Other former coaches include Uwe Spiedel, Mersad Selimbegovic, Jens Härtel, Patrick Glöckner, Pavel Dotchev, and Christian Brand.

Hansa Rostock plays their home matches at Ostseestadion in Rostock, which has a capacity of 29,000.
